Pradhan Mantri National Apprenticeship Mela 2023: The Pradhan Mantri National Apprenticeship Mela (PMNAM) will be organized in more than 200 districts across the country and will see the participation of many local businesses. Many leading companies representing various sectors are also participating in this.
Companies and candidates interested in participating in the Apprenticeship Fair can register for the Fair by visiting apprenticeshipindia.gov.in and msde.gov.in.
Jobs for 5th pass to 12th pass
Candidates who are class 5th to 12th pass or having skill training certificate or ITI certificate holder or diploma holder or graduate can apply for this Apprenticeship Fair. Candidates have to carry their Resume, three copies of all mark sheets and certificates, photo identity proof (Aadhar Card/Driving License etc.) and three passport size photographs to the respective venues.
Reached the nearest fair with documents
The locations are also available on the Apprenticeship Mela portal (dgt.gov.in/appmela2022/). Those who have already enrolled are requested to reach the venue with all relevant documents. Through this fair, candidates can also get National Council for Vocational Education and Training (NCVET) recognized certificates, which will improve their employability rate after the training sessions.
More than 22 lakh apprentices got appointments
Apprenticeship fairs are organized across the country on the second Monday of every month. As per the
IndiaSkills 2023 report, more than 22 lakh active apprentices have been placed so far. In these melas, selected individuals are offered apprenticeship opportunities during which they receive a monthly stipend as per government norms to acquire new skills.
